Holistic Approach to Language Proficiency

All areas of language acquisition and proficiency are interconnected. To focus on one area in isolation presents an incomplete picture and often leaves students unsure of how to apply what they have learned. At E360, we support students’ English language proficiency by integrating instruction in language conventions and usage, reading, and writing. In this approach, each area of language acquisition supports the others.By learning these areas of language as parts of a whole, students reinforce their knowledge of language by seeing its application in written texts and applying it in their own writing.

Language for Learning

Whether written or spoken, formal or informal, language is the medium through which the vast amount of school learning takes place. In this sense, the need for language proficiency goes well beyond the English classroom, extending to all academic subjects. In order to succeed, students need to effectively apply their language skills, including reading and writing, across various disciplines. This is especially true as students advance in grade level: subject material utilizes more academic language while students are expected to work more independently. At E360, we aim not only to provide students with a solid foundation in language skills, but to develop their ability to apply these skills across all academic subjects.

Academic Language

At E360, we aim to support students’ growth through a focus on academic language, not just in English, but in all areas of instruction. Academic language refers to both the general academic and domain-specific vocabulary and the syntactic structures found within academic and professional discourse. That these words and phrases are so widespread is no coincidence; they help convey complex ideas critically and precisely. Our belief is that through increased familiarity with academic language, students can better understand and evaluate subject matter.
